The Town of Campobello operates as a “Council” form of     
government. There is a Mayor and four Council Members who
serve four-year staggered terms. The Mayor and Council are
elected at large in non-partisan elections.  The Mayor serves as
the principal spokesperson and representative of the Town and is
the presiding officer at Council meetings.

Town Council is the legislative body of the Town and adopts
Town Ordinances and amends them as needed. Council also
determines what Town taxes shall be levied and how funds are
spent.
